/*
Theme Name: Avada Child
Description: Child theme for the Avada
Author: Your name here
Template: Avada
*/
.scholarship { background: #f8f8f8; padding: 10px 15px 5px; margin: 0 0 20px; border: 1px dashed #ccc; border-radius: 5px; }
.scholarship .meta-info { border-color:transparent !important; margin-top: 10px !important; font-size: 14px; text-transform: uppercase; }
.scholarship h3 { color: #3a547c !important; font-family: "MuseoSlab500Regular",arial,helvetica,sans-serif !important; }
.scholarship p { word-wrap: break-word; }
.scholarship-dropdown { border: 1px solid; float: right; padding: 3px; }
.filter { border: 1px solid #ccc; padding:10px; position: relative; margin: 0 0 20px; color: #3a547c; }
.filter h3 { background: #fff; padding: 0 10px; position: absolute; top: -26px; }
.search { margin:15px 0; }
.search button { background: #222 none repeat scroll 0 0; border: medium none; color: #fff; float: right; padding: 7px 10px; position: relative; top: 30px; }
.filter .purpose input { width:auto; }
.filter input { background: #f2f2f2 none repeat scroll 0 0 !important; border: medium none !important; box-shadow: none; color: #333 !important; padding: 8px 15px; width:100%; }
.filter input[type="submit"] { background: #222 !important; color:#fff !important; width: 100%; cursor: pointer; }
label.error { color:#ff0000; font-size:12px; }
div.purpose { position:relative; height:172px; overflow:auto; }
div.purpose label.error { position:absolute; left:0; bottom:-17px; }
.zmshbt.long-shadows a { float:left; }
.page-template-scholarship .pagination-top .pagination { float: left; margin-top: -37px; margin-left: 10px; }
@media screen and (min-width: 601px) {
    #career-test { width: 600px; height: 400px; }
}
@media screen and (max-width: 600px) {
    #career-test { width: 100% !important; min-height: 550px; }
}
@media screen and (max-width: 360px) { 
	.scholarship { overflow: hidden;	}
	.scholarship div { float: left; width:100%; overflow: hidden;	}
}

/* -------- START --------*/
/* ---- icu2-Dom Suto ----*/
/* -------- START --------*/
#home-page-bottom-boxes img{
	width: 360px;
}
.page-id-4053 img.aligncenter {
    width: 100%!important;
}
ul.iss_results {
    z-index: 999999;
}

.page-id-4053 h3 {
    padding-left: 7px!important;
}
span#quiz-home-page img {
    width: 328px;
}

@media screen and (max-width: 800px) {
.fusion-mobile-menu-icons {
    position: relative;
    top: 21px;
}
span#quiz-home-page img {
    display: none;
}
}
@media screen and (max-width: 700px) {
.slide-excerpt p {
    display: none;
}
.slide-excerpt h2 {
    font-size: 22px!important;
}
.fusion-flexslider.flexslider-posts-with-excerpt .slide-excerpt h2 {
    padding: 0px!important;
}
}

@media screen and (max-width: 500px) {
.slide-excerpt h2 {
    font-size: 11px!important;
}
.fusion-logo img {
    max-height: 40px!important;
}
.fusion-mobile-menu-icons {
    position: relative;
    top: 10px;
}

}
